INJECTION 7: IDP/REFUGEE FOOD RIOTS (EVENT+25 WEEKS)
- By week ten, 70% of the former rice producing land is cleared, prepared, and sown with rice. Generally, from planting to household kitchen is 14 weeks. Late in the growing cycle it becomes obvious that the harvest will be minimal.
- The influx of Cambodian refugees has placed regional pressure on food producers already faced with cleaning up after the typhoon – shortages of staples are causing riots in the IDP/Refugee camps
- The storm has taxed strategic stores of rice severely. However, Vietnam has pre-negotiated with other countries to help share their food stores.
- Food riots have broken out on Cambodia-Thailand border.
